Did a 2 litre yesterday.
Get it nice and hot, whip out the drain plug and leave it for an hour or so while you do something else.
Take the filter out and the filler cap off too. If the filter is still in place it seals some oil within the housing.

Then I simply measured 4.25 litres and poured it in. After a little run and warm up the elctronic gauge showed full.
